I have a 5 year old toy poodle. For probably the last month or so, he has been chasing nothing. He's jumping, almost doing back-flips, running into the corner, trying to climb the walls. It's getting worse. He spends probaby up to 3/4 of his day chasing 'nothing'. When I watch him, it looks like he's chasing a bird, it was always above his head, but in the last couple of days, it sometimes looks like he's chasing something on the floor. There is nothing there, we watch him, and try to 'snap him out of it', by calling his name or petting him. We're getting worried about him, it's almost like he's going crazy. I talked to the vet, he said it sounds like a behavioral problem. Any ideas?
